Why do people pronounce Mario as Mary O?
On the Super Mario TV show, the animated segments pronounce it Mah-reeo but the live-action skits pronounce it Mary-oh. So people can’t seem to agree even on a single tv show episode. Probably because of other famous Mario’s, like Lemieux or Andretti. With them, it’s usually pronounced “merry-oh”.

How do New Yorkers say Mario?
In New York State it is generally pronounced (maa rio) like map or match. However the (mar ee o) pronounciation is gaining in popularity in New York State, especially among young people.
How do I spell Luigi?
Luigi is a masculine Italian given name. It is the Italian form of the German name Ludwig, through the Latinization Ludovicus, corresponding to the French form Louis and its anglicized variant Lewis….Luigi (name)
| Pronunciation | Italian: [luˈiːdʒi] |
| Gender | male |
| Origin | |
|---|---|
| Word/name | Ludwig (Chlodwig) |
| Meaning | renowned/famous warrior |

Is it pronounced GIF of JIF?
“It’s pronounced JIF, not GIF.” Just like the peanut butter. “The Oxford English Dictionary accepts both pronunciations,” Wilhite told The New York Times. “They are wrong. It is a soft ‘G,’ pronounced ‘jif.
How do New Yorkers say radiator?
A: No, the pronunciation of “radiator” as RAH-dee-ay-ter (rhymes with “gladiator”) is not unique to Queens. It’s not very common, though. Stewart (an ex-New Yorker) is familiar with it, while Pat (an ex-Iowan) can’t remember ever hearing it.
